Enhance detection and quality control
The Key Technology optical inspection systems are designed to meticulously scrutinize poultry and seafood products for contaminants and quality defects. These systems utilize advanced cameras and lasers capable of detecting foreign objects, such as bones, shells, and other unwanted materials, ensuring high product integrity. The optical sorters are equipped with multispectral imaging technology that can distinguish between good and defective items based on color, shape, size, and structural properties.
